My car has suffered a noticeable performance drop and I suspect the Diesel Particulate Filter and turbocharger are at the root of the problem. I need someone who can carry out a thorough inspection, run the relevant OBD-II diagnostics, and confirm whether the DPF is clogged, the turbo is under-boosting, or both. Once the checks are complete, please send me: • A concise report of the test readings (back-pressure, boost, fault codes). • Clear recommendations on next steps—cleaning, replacement parts, or further calibration. If you have experience with DPF regeneration tools, smoke/boost-leak testing, and the software typically used for modern car ECUs, your expertise will fit perfectly.
